Physics-based Simulation in Visual Computing

Dominik L. Michels, Associate Professor, Computer Science
Sep 4, 11:30 - 12:30

B9 L2 H2 H2

visual computing machine learning physics-based simulation

This talk covers a selection of previous and current work presenting a broad spectrum of research highlights ranging from simulating stiff phenomena such as the dynamics of fibers and textiles, over liquids containing magnetic particles, to the development of complex ecosystems and weather phenomena. Moreover, connection points to the growing field of machine learning are addressed and an outlook is provided with respect to selected technology transfer activities.
